## Who to Contact: Quillbox Address Autocomplete

External plugin authors integrating the Quillbox autocomplete widget should route questions by topic. API surface changes and versioning are handled by the Widget Platform group. Styling and theming issues belong to the Embeds team. For licensing, rate limits, or anything not covered in the plugin docs, write to the integrations desk.

escalation mailbox, yajeg-bageg: quenax.olidor@lumiccorp.internal

Alert: MERIDIAN-RECON-DRIFT. The Meridian inventory reconciliation job compares warehouse counts from the Coppervale scanner feed against ledger balances every hour. This alert fires when unexplained drift exceeds 0.5% across any single facility for two consecutive runs. It usually indicates a delayed scanner batch rather than genuine shrinkage, so confirm feed timestamps before escalating to the warehouse leads. Per-facility drift figures, run history, and the escalation checklist are maintained on the internal triage page.

runbook for badug-kadup: https://confluence.zemvarlabs.internal/projects/browse/display/projects/bd1b

## Step 3: Switch to Cursor Pagination

Offset pagination is removed in Lanternfish API v4. Replace `page` and `per_page` with `cursor` and `limit`. Cursors are opaque; do not parse them. Update your client, then backfill any stored offsets by running `scripts/rekey_cursors.rb` against staging. The script needs direct access to the pagination index table, so run it with the connection string below.

primary connection of kahof-kagep = mssql://belath_svc:3uqY4g6LHG5Nyi@db-d0ba.ferralabs.corp:5432/rusdor